Technical Aim Analysis & Sensitivity Math for aspas

aspas is a professional Valorant player currently competing for MIBR. To maintain peak mechanical aim and crosshair stability in VCT competitions, aspas uses a Logitech G Pro X Superlight 2 Whiteconfigured with a DPI setting of 800 and an in-game sensitivity of 0.37. This yields an Effective DPI (eDPI) of 296.

Physical Mouse Distance (360° Turn): At an eDPI of 296, executing a complete 360-degree in-game rotation requires approximately 103.7 cm (or 40.8 inches) of physical mousepad movement. This places aspas's sensitivity in the Medium eDPI (Hybrid Aiming) category, which optimizes micro-adjustments for long-range engagements while retaining enough speed to check corners.
